Unveiling the Secrets of Articles: Exact and General

Articles, those tiny copyright at the beginning of countless nouns, often go unnoticed. Yet, their unassuming presence can profoundly influence the meaning in written communication. The definite article "the" points to something specific, while the indefinite articles "a" and "an" refer to non-specific concepts. Mastering this distinction is crucial for crafting precise and concise language.

  • Consider the difference between "I saw a dog" and "I saw the dog." The first implies any random dog, while the second refers to a particular dog.
  • Comparably, "He bought a car" suggests any automobile, whereas "He bought the car" signifies a designated car.

Frequent Mistakes about Articles: How to Avoid They

Writing effectively involves mastering the subtle nuances of language, and articles are no exception. Some writers make common mistakes with articles, leading to awkward phrasing and confusion. One frequent error is incorrectly using "a" and "an." Remember, "a" precedes consonant sounds, while "an" precedes vowel sounds. For example, we say "a book" but "an apple." Another pitfall is overusing the article "the," which should be reserved for specific nouns already mentioned or understood by the reader. Avoid unnecessary copyright by omitting "the" when it's implied. Finally, be mindful of articles in phrases where they can affect meaning. Pay close attention to context and choose the article that accurately conveys your intended message.
